Sharan Burrow

Former General Secretary, International Trade Union Confederation (ITUC)
Global Board of Director, World Resources Institute

Sharan Burrow is a global advocate for human rights, climate action and Just Transition. She is the Former General Secretary of the International Trade Union Confederation from 2010 to 2022. Previously, she was President of the Australian Council of Trade Unions from 2000 to 2010.

Sharan is well known for her international advocacy on employment, human rights, industrial relations, corporate responsibility and climate action with green industrialisation and just transition solutions. 

Sharan is currently a Visiting Professor in Practice to the LSE-Grantham Institute and chair of its Just Transition Finance Lab’s Advisory Council, a Vice-Chair of the European Climate Foundation, a board member of the Green Hydrogen Association, Co-Chair of the IEA Labour Council, an adviser on Temasek’s Sustainability Advisory Panel, and Chair of the Curtain University’s Institute for Energy Transition Advisory Council.
